Find the least common multiple of each set of numbers. 4, 10, 12

Least Common Multiple of 4, 10, 12.

2 <u>| 4, 10, 12</u>

2 |<u> 2, 5, 6</u>

5 |<u> 1, 5, 3</u>

3 <u>| 1, 1, 3</u>

1 <u>| 1, 1, 1</u>

_______________

2 × 2 × 5 × 3 × 1

= 2² × 5 × 3 × 1

= 4 × 5 × 3 × 1

= 20 × 3 × 1

= 60 × 1

= <u>60</u>

________________

Least Common Multiple (LCM) of 4, 10, 12 is \boxed{\underline{\bf \: 60}}

Mr. Mole left his burrow that lies below the ground and started digging his way at a constant rate deeper into the ground.
Marizza181 [45]

Answer:

A(t)=-1.8t-4.5

Step-by-step explanation:

Mr.Mole's digging can be described by a linear model of general equation:

A(t)=m*t+c

Where "m" is the rate at which he descends. Note that since the function A(t) measure his altitude relative to the ground, the rate "m" must be negative.

(m=-1.8)

A(t)=-1.8*t+c

The constant "c" is his starting position. To find this value, assign the given data at t = 5 min to the equation above

-13.5=-1.8*5+c\\c=-4.5m

Therefore, the function A(t) is described by the following formula:
A(t)=-1.8t-4.5
